The Workforce Improvement Project (WIP) is a 3-year project (2009-2012) that focuses on the richness of cultural diversity in nursing and improving psychosocial and academic student nurse success at CSUF. This project is involved with pre-licensure (EL-BSN), on-campus associate to baccalaureate degree completion program students (RN-BSN), and the pre-nursing students who are taking pre-requisite courses for the nursing baccalaureate program.
We hope to gain a better understanding of our nursing students' needs through the use of assessment tools, focus groups, and surveys. We plan to facilitate the use of resources to augment student campus and academic experiences, and support student-to-student peer mentoring.
The WIP has included panel discussions of nursing careers and celebrations of diversity! Selected groups of students already admitted to the BSN Program as well as pre-nursing students may also receive scholarships or stipends.
Workforce Improvement Project goals include:
• Improved student perceptions of acceptance by peers and faculty
• Enhanced social support of friends and family
• Decreased cultural dissonance and related stress while at CSUF
• Improved academic performance and progress, leading to lower attrition and improved graduation rates in the CSUF School of Nursing
